详解Python中expandtabs()方法的使用


Posted in Python onMay 18, 2015

 expandtabs()方法返回制表符,即该字符串的一个副本。 '\t'已经使用的空间,可选择使用给定的tabsize(默认8)扩展。
语法

以下是expandtabs()方法的语法:

str.expandtabs(tabsize=8)

参数

  •     tabsize -- 此选项指定要替换为制表符“\t' 的字符数.

返回值

此方法返回在制表符,即通过空格进行了扩展字符串,'\t'的副本。
例子

下面的例子显示expandtabs()方法的使用。

#!/usr/bin/python

str = "this is\tstring example....wow!!!";


print "Original string: " + str;
print "Defualt exapanded tab: " + str.expandtabs();
print "Double exapanded tab: " + str.expandtabs(16);

当我们运行上面的程序,它会产生以下结果:

Original string: this is    string example....wow!!!
Defualt exapanded tab: this is string example....wow!!!
Double exapanded tab: this is     string example....wow!!!
Python 相关文章推荐
Python实现Linux下守护进程的编写方法
Aug 22 Python
Python文件夹与文件的相关操作(推荐)
Jul 25 Python
Python3.4编程实现简单抓取爬虫功能示例
Sep 14 Python
python 将数据保存为excel的xls格式(实例讲解)
May 03 Python
浅谈python中np.array的shape( ,)与( ,1)的区别
Jun 04 Python
对python中的 os.mkdir和os.mkdirs详解
Oct 16 Python
selenium+python环境配置教程详解
May 28 Python
Django使用unittest模块进行单元测试过程解析
Aug 02 Python
PyCharm无法引用自身项目解决方式
Feb 12 Python
python的json包位置及用法总结
Jun 21 Python
python打开文件的方式有哪些
Jun 29 Python
python3中数组逆序输出方法
Dec 01 Python
Python中处理字符串之endswith()方法的使用简介
May 18 #Python
Python中encode()方法的使用简介
May 18 #Python
简单介绍Python中的decode()方法的使用
May 18 #Python
Python虚拟环境Virtualenv使用教程
May 18 #Python
Python字符串处理之count()方法的使用
May 18 #Python
收藏整理的一些Python常用方法和技巧
May 18 #Python
简介Python中用于处理字符串的center()方法
May 18 #Python
You might like
php number_format() 函数通过千位分组来格式化数字的实现代码
2013/08/06 PHP
Linux下源码包安装Swoole及基本使用操作图文详解
2019/04/02 PHP
javascript 动态修改样式和层叠样式表代码
2010/04/27 Javascript
JavaScript实现点击按钮后变灰避免多次重复提交
2013/07/15 Javascript
JQuery节点元素属性操作方法
2015/06/11 Javascript
javascript实现给定半径求出圆的面积
2015/06/26 Javascript
javascript动态获取登录时间和在线时长
2016/02/25 Javascript
Js获取当前日期时间及格式化代码
2016/09/17 Javascript
ES6学习之变量的解构赋值
2017/02/12 Javascript
详解从angular-cli:1.0.0-beta.28.3升级到@angular/cli:1.0.0
2017/05/22 Javascript
使用jQuery实现页面定时弹出广告效果
2017/08/24 jQuery
H5实现仿flash效果的实现代码
2017/09/29 Javascript
Vue2 轮播图slide组件实例代码
2018/05/31 Javascript
Angular中使用ng-zorro图标库部分图标不能正常显示问题
2019/04/22 Javascript
Vue项目中配置pug解析支持
2019/05/10 Javascript
微信小程序实现左滑删除效果
2020/11/18 Javascript
跟老齐学Python之使用Python查询更新数据库
2014/11/25 Python
浅谈pycharm下找不到sqlalchemy的问题
2018/12/03 Python
python模拟点击网页按钮实现方法
2020/02/25 Python
ASP.NET Core中的配置详解
2021/02/05 Python
纯CSS3代码实现switch滑动开关按钮效果
2016/08/30 HTML / CSS
AmazeUI图片轮播效果的示例代码
2020/08/20 HTML / CSS
Rhone官方网站:男士运动服装、健身服装和高级运动服
2019/05/01 全球购物
Android面试题及答案
2015/09/04 面试题
若干个Java基础面试题
2015/05/19 面试题
机械设计职业生涯规划书
2013/12/27 职场文书
报关员个人职业生涯规划书
2014/03/12 职场文书
夏季药店促销方案
2014/08/22 职场文书
2015年党员公开承诺书范文
2015/01/22 职场文书
酒店员工辞职信范文
2015/02/28 职场文书
公路施工安全责任书
2015/05/08 职场文书
就业指导讲座心得体会
2016/01/15 职场文书
基于go interface{}==nil 的几种坑及原理分析
2021/04/24 Golang
一篇带你入门Java垃圾回收器
2021/06/16 Java/Android
《乙女游戏世界对路人角色很不友好》OP主题曲无字幕动画MV公开
2022/04/05 日漫
Python如何加载模型并查看网络
2022/07/15 Python